Responsibilities
- To execute futures and options, forex, securities and related orders for all clients
- To provide fundamental and technical analyses to clients
- To provide trade support services to customers including market information and performance, monitor and advice on client margin calls and facilities, trading limits, solving of out-trades
- To ensure work and duties are carried out professionally, and comply with all rules and regulations of local /overseas regulators and exchanges
- To assist back-office departments in trade-related work, ensure institutional customers’ trade confirmations are promptly emailed to the customers. Copies of such confirmations are to be given to the Operations team (settlement)
- To solicit and provide feedback on any customers’ unusual trading patterns (e.g sudden over-speculative behaviors), patterns of movement of funds, to HODs and Compliance department.
- To monitor activities (asides from trading within limits and margin sufficiency) that could be related to money laundering and terrorism financing. Must have a good understanding of the factors which contribute to arouse suspicion in such activities
- To check and monitor customer’s equity and position limits to ensure no over-trading
- To escalate immediately on occurrence of error, to ensure a detailed account of error report is made promptly
